I come of a seafarin' fambly." He crossed the platform; when he had gone thirty yards further he stopped, turned around, and shouted: "Is she a schooner, hey?
You want to know is she a schooner?
If you was askin' me, she ain't NOTHIN' now.

But if you was to ask me again I might say she COULD be schooner-rigged.

Lots of boats IS schooner-rigged." There are affinities between atom and atom, between man and woman, between man and man.

There are also affinities between men and things-if you choose to call a ship, which has a spirit of its own, merely a thing.

There must have been this affinity between Cleggett and the Jasper B.
